Red Hat expands Cloud footprint 
Red Hat has announced the next step in its delivery of open hybrid cloud solutions to enterprises with the general availability of Red Hat CloudForms. CloudForms is an open hybrid cloud management platform built to enable enterprises to create and manage Infrastructure-as-a-Service (IaaS) hybrid clouds with the ability to make self-service computing resources available to users in a managed, governed and secure way.
Brian Stevens, CTO & VP, Worldwide Engineering, Red Hat said, “CloudForms enables enterprises to use infrastructure ranging from virtual to public cloud resources together in open hybrid cloud architecture and is a game-changer for enterprises leveraging the power of the cloud. We recognize that for a complete open hybrid cloud, enterprises need more than just the management layer - they also need openness and portability across compute, data/services, programming models and applications. Red Hat is the only vendor that can deliver a portfolio of solutions to meets these needs, and we’ve further extended this with the availability of a new cloud platform with groundbreaking features via CloudForms.”
